Netvořice Monthly Rainfall & Precipitation
This page shows both the average monthly rainfall and the number of rainy days in Netvořice, Central Bohemia, Czech Republic. These averages rely on historical data collected over 30 years, from 1990 to 2020. Let's explore the details to provide you with a complete overview.
Generally, Netvořice has a moderate amount of precipitation, averaging 741 mm (29 in) of rain/snowfall annually.

Netvořice offers a pleasant mix of wetter and slightly drier months. The difference in precipitation between July (90 mm (3.5 in)) and February (45 mm (1.8 in)) is not too significant, making the climate enjoyable for visitors and residents alike.
July, the wettest month, has a maximum daytime temperature of 25°C (77°F). The city receives 226 hours of sunshine in this period. During the driest month February you can expect a temperature of 5°C (41°F). For more detailed insights into the city's temperatures, visit our Netvořice Temperature page.

Precipitation amounts are measured using specific gauges installed at weather stations, collecting both rain and snow and any other type of precipitation. Rainfall is measured directly in millimeters, while that from snow and ice is obtained by melting it. Automated systems often incorporate heaters to make this easier.
Information from these stations is transmitted via Wi-Fi, satellite, GPS, or telephone connections to central monitoring networks. This information is immediately updated and integrated into weather models and forecasts.
